We have 3 Hard standing pitches with a generous grass surround for your awning 

Plus 2 grass pitches which are open during the drier months

All the touring pitches are suitable for Caravans, motorhomes, camper vans, trailer tents and roof tents.

Facilities

  • Shower and toilet hut with proper flushing toilets and hot showers 

  • Welcome hut with local information and solar phone charging points and freezer.

  • Each pitch has a picnic table or table and chairs.

  • Fire pits are available to hire at a cost of £10 per night including logs.

  • Dog walking area - please keep dogs on a lead at all times.

  • Covered washing up area 

  • Fresh water point

  • Grey water point

  • Chemical toilet disposal point - please note we are only able to take Green chemical which is readily available from most caravan supplies shops and generally costs the same but is much better for the environment.

  • Recycling facilities - please keep any rubbish to a minimum

  • Way marked, Farm nature walk around a small lake.

Sustainable tourism

We are passionate about sustainable tourism and we operate as an Eco off grid campsite so no electric pitches.  But we do have amazing dark skies and an abundance of nature.

Pets

We warmly welcome dogs at Tranwell Farm and know they’re very much part of the family. You will have access to walks around the farm, our on-site nature trail and dedicated dog walking field, plenty of space for tails to wag. Please keep dogs on a lead at all times.
